Mulch covers the dirt and protects against crusting, compaction, and water dissipation. Mulch covers the dirt and protects against crusting, compaction, and water evaporation.
Mulch also lowers the number of weeds in a water-wise landscape by protecting against light-induced germination of weed seeds. With fewer weeds, much less growing is needed, which can prevent damages to plant roots, dirt structure, and soil microorganisms. Additionally, compost moderates dirt temperature level and shields plant roots. In wintertime, small amounts of soil temperature can stop plants from heaving out of the ground as a result of cold and thawing.
Organic composts consist of materials such as timber or bark chips, shredded bark, nut coverings, want needles, or various other disposed of plant components. These materials have the potential to improve dirt framework, rise soil fertility, prevent compaction, and increase soil raw material as they break down and are included right into the soil.
To make certain ample water infiltration and oygenation and to slow disintegration, make sure compost bits are bigger than the underlying dirt fragments (usually bigger than a half inch in size). Recycled plant materials have to be cost-free from weed seeds, disease-causing organisms, and chemical and herbicide deposits. You can either utilize healthsome plant parts that have not been chemically dealt with, or you can compost your mulch before usage.
Nitrogen loss can be prevented by utilizing composted mulch or by adding nitrogen at a price of 1-2 pounds real N per 1000 ft2. In time, organic mulches break down and will need to be replenished. Replenishment can be accomplished just by adding even more compost over the top of the broken down mulch product.

The size of not natural compost bits should complement the scale of the landscape.
A 2-inch thick layer of mulch calls for about 6 cubic yards of product per 1000 square feet of location. Leave a couple of inches of mulch-free area around the base of woody plants to avoid root collar illness and rodent damages. The most effective time to apply compost is instantly after planting in the loss, or in the spring after the dirt has heated.
Along with preserving water, appropriate watering can urge much deeper origin development and healthier, extra drought forgiving landscapes. A vital part of water-efficient landscaping is producing hydrozones for your watering requires. To supply ample water to all plants without over or under-watering some, group plants with similar irrigation needs in one area.
Another crucial element of watering planning consists of routine maintenance of the system. Regular monthly exam of the watering system, while in operation, will certainly assist you to find and repair any type of busted, misaligned, or clogged sprinkler heads and maintain your system running efficiently. It is crucial to identify sub-surface soil wetness. Dirt wetness can be identified utilizing a dirt wetness probe. Trees or shrubs must be watered to a depth of 18-20 inches. The amount of water to use in any circumstance depends on the soil type. Sandy dirts soak up water the fastest (concerning 2" per hour), complied with by loam soils (3/4" per hour).
By enabling water to permeate much deeper right into the dirt profile, you are motivating deeper rooting and a more drought forgiving plant. Regular, light watering will certainly lead to plants that have a superficial origin system which are a lot more susceptible to water stress. For example, a lot of deciduous hedges (bushes that drop their leaves in fall) advantage from thinning cuts that open their canopy and get rid of old or contending stems. Thinning cuts are made by cutting a branch back to its factor of beginning. The factor of origin might be an additional branch or the main trunk, or it might be near the ground
A heading cut is more extreme than a thinning cut, and removes part of a branch leaving a short stub above a bud. This kind of cut promotes a wealth of twiggy development from a lateral bud just listed below the cut. It is made use of to promote new development from a side bud to complete a void in the canopy, or to increase flower production in some bushes.
Overuse of heading cuts can destroy the all-natural form of a tree or bush. Shearing is the most severe kind of heading cut and entails cutting a plant's outer vegetation to produce an also surface area. Only specific trees and shrubs will profit from this type of cut. Shearing can be used to produce a hedge or screen with very closely spaced plants.
